Помогите написать небольшой софт.

Суть такова - надо заменять в шапке файла первые хекс значения на свои. Но файлов кучка, а руками делать не годно. Подскажите решение проблемы. Программа ведь должна выйти небольшой, верно?
 
1,683
1
>[font=Verdana, Helvetica, Arial, sans-serif]первые хекс значения на свои[/font][font=Verdana, Helvetica, Arial, sans-serif]Давай объясни,что это значит.[/font]
 
Допустим. В HEX значениях файла первые 4 блока равны каким то значениям. Надо их заменять на свои, но не ручками, а программкой. Программкой в плане того, что надо написать софт, который будет брать файлы из каталога и в каждом из них заменять первые четыре HEX блока по горизонтали на определенные.
 
1,683
1
Files.walk читает твои файлы рекурсивно (по папкам,и папкам в них).Потом добавь в какой-нибудь лист(в 8 джаве можно фильтровать и добавлять в 1 строку).Потом читай всё,заменяй на своё(в hex надо перевести).Как-то так,делал подобное(читал мд5 каждого файла и закидывал в конец,изменив Cipher'ом)
 
Я конечно все понял, но т.к. я дуб, то реализовать нихера не смогу.
 
329
13
Я в Java не силён. Я бы сделал на php:
fread() или file_get_contents() ;
Замена на то, что нужно ;
fwrite() .
 
Сверху